Chip Solution Battery Power Management Chip TP4120
Input as TYPEC block
Input voltage: 5V
The battery is 18650 cells, or in direct welding mode.
FAN interface is XH2.54 2p
Instructions:
Short press K1 to display battery power, long press to turn off fan output.
K2 short press 3rd gear + close cycle, long press to turn on LED lighting.
TYPE input charging LED4 lights up
TP4120 is a portable USB fan control chip.
The chip integrates charging management functions, boost management functions, protection functions, button control and gear indication functions, etc.
Provides a single-chip solution for portable USB fan applications powered by lithium batteries.
TP4120 adopts linear charging technology with a fixed charging current of 800mA.
It supports trickle charging and constant temperature charging modes at the same time, and has charging and full LED indication functions.
TP4120 supports 5V/6V/7V three-speed boost output, and the three-speed output can be switched by pressing the button.
TP4120 integrates gear position LED indication and flashlight function.
TP4120 has a variety of gear switching modes, which can be configured by connecting the MODEA and MODEB pins to high and low levels to meet a variety of application needs.
TP4120 integrates a variety of protection functions to ensure system stability and reliability.
Including over-temperature protection, over-charge and over-discharge protection, output over-voltage protection, output short-circuit protection, etc.
At the same time, the application circuit of TP4120 is simple and requires only a few components to realize a complete portable charging fan solution, which greatly saves the cost and size of the system.
